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
137 283064 977291438 95038303 796634032
1579141347 45942 843242
1579141347 45942 843242
378480883 6596615 918207
All about undefined
Interested in learning more?
1579141347 45942 843242
378480883 6596615 918207
See more
1760299251 5608763006
97 39 874538
See more
4609 236498 9813065199
37 65 32955872598 9335
See more